A Comprehensive Overview of the Game of Hockey
Hockey is a fast-paced sport that captivates audiences around the world. Whether played on ice, field, or indoors, the essence of the game remains the same: two teams face off to score points by sending a puck or ball into the opponent’s goal. With a rich history and strong cultural significance, hockey has evolved into a global phenomenon.
The Roots and Evolution of Hockey
The origins of hockey can be traced back centuries, with variations of the game being played in different parts of the world. Modern ice hockey, however, began to take shape in the 19th century in Canada. The sport has come a long way since then, growing to include a variety of forms such as field hockey and indoor roller hockey, each with unique rules and player dynamics.

The Structure and Rules of Hockey
The fundamental goal of hockey is simple, yet achieving it requires skill, strategy, and teamwork. Here are some basic rules:
- Teams: Typically consist of six players, including a goaltender.
- Periods: A standard game is divided into three periods, each lasting 20 minutes in ice hockey.
- Scoring: Points are scored by getting the puck past the opposing goaltender into the goal.
- Positions: Include forwards, defensemen, and a goaltender, each responsible for specific roles on the ice.
- Penalties: Penalties are incurred for actions like tripping, high-sticking, and interference. They can result in players being sent to the penalty box, giving the opposing team a temporary advantage called a power play.
